If you are looking to use "Enterprise Voice" (voice breakout between the OCS
and PBX environment) as opposed to setting up "Remote Call Control". It
might be simpler to employ a seperate MS supported SIP-E1/T1 gateway, and
fitting an E1/T1 card to the PBX(s).
This would also give a good demarcation point.
